On GoGrid, data transfer is measured in gigabytes. There are no charges for data transfer between servers over the private network within a single data center. There are also no costs associated with inbound transfer going to your servers. You will only be charged based on your outbound transfer. Because all inbound data is free, data transfer charges are not charged until you turn the virtual server on and send data.

CloudLink lets customers have a direct connection between GoGrid's data centers. GoGrid customers that purchase CloudLink take advantage of a redundant, private, dedicated connection, which means fewer hops and less conflict with other traffic. CloudLink is an unmetered product; users can push any amount of traffic they wish. Customers are charged only for the bandwidth speed they desire and may purchase multiple instances of these links.
